Hunting for Greek speaking Ostamate in the Chicago area
Question:
Hi— This is an unusual one, but in our Ostomy Visitor Program we have an ostomate who only speaks Greek. We wish to help him and hope we can find a similar ostomate in the Chicago area. Any help would be appreciated—- Thanks– Royg
Response:
I’m sure you already tried this, but if not, Royg, what about the Orthodox churches in the Chicago area? Speak directly to the priest or their secretaries to get the message to them. They know who is who, and what, etc. in their parishes and if anyone is available, the priests could expedite contact. Even if not a church member, but Greek speaking, the priests will know. Trust me. Good luck.
